Windowsnbsp;XP自动开关机的实现
??今天有這么一個想法,想讓自己的電腦,可以在我不在的時候也能每天定時開機和關機 ,呵呵!你是不是也有這個想法呢,特別是做個人服務器的朋友,有了這個想法,就要想怎么實現啦!我喜歡簡單。所以我決定向大家,介紹這種方法啦。
1.自動開機。這個有個條件,就是你的主板要支持才行,哦,可能你已經明白,用什么方法啦!是的就是要利用bios來實現.重啟進入BIOS設置主界面中,不同的主板也可以有小小的區別.好了,選擇“Power Management Setup”,進入電源管理窗口。默認情況下,“Resume By Alarm(定時開機)”選項是關閉的,將光標移到該項,用“Pagedown”鍵將“Disabled”改為“Enabled”,此時“Resume By Alarm”選項下原本是灰色的日期和時間設置會變亮。將光標先后移到“Date Alarm(開機日期)”和“TimeAlarm(開機時間)”上,用“Pageup”、“Pagedown”設定好,我們這里可以設置每天的某點某分可以開機。設置好后,保存重啟,就可以啦,到了設置的時候,電腦就會自動開機啦!我設定了早上9點就開機,順便在開機的時候,放上一段不錯的音樂。呵呵!。想想,每天不用自己開機就可以放音樂,啊,多美妙!!不過開機的進入系統的時候不能有密碼,要不就停在那里啦。
2.自動關機。這個主要最簡單的方法是用at和shutdown兩個命令。Windows XP的關機是由Shutdown.exe程序來控制的,可以在Windows\System32文件夾找到 。看看怎么用這兩個命令:可以選擇“開始→運行”,輸入“at **:** Shutdown -s” 。如果你想在23:00 關機,可以這樣設置:“at 23:00 Shutdown -s”。默認有30秒鐘的倒計時并提示你保存工作。如果那時侯還有工作要做,怎么取消呢!這個容易。可以在運行中輸入“shutdown -a”。另外輸入“shutdown -i”,則可以打開設置自動關機對話框,對自動關機進行設置。?
 ?為了大家對at和shutdown命令有更多的認識。我給出他們的詳細的功能介紹:1.shutdown命令的參數
 ?Shutdown允許您關閉或重新啟動本地或遠程計算機。如果沒有使用參數,shutdown 將注銷當前用戶。
 ?語法shutdown [{-l|-s|-r|-a}] [-f] [-m [\\ComputerName]] [-t xx] [-c "message"] [-d[u][p]:xx:yy]
 ?參數-l 注銷當前用戶,這是默認設置。-m ComputerName 優先。 -s 關閉本地計算機。 -r 關閉之后重新啟動。 -a 中止關閉。除了 -l 和 ComputerName 外,系統將忽略其它參數。在超時期間,您只可以使用 -a。 -f 強制運行要關閉的應用程序。 -m [\\ComputerName] 指定要關閉的計算機。 -t xx 將用于系統關閉的定時器設置為 xx 秒,即倒計時設置。如:
 shutdown? -s - t 3600,將在3600秒后關閉,默認值是 20 秒。 -c "message" 指定將在“系統關閉”窗口中的“消息”區域顯示的消息。最多可以使用 127 個字符。引號中必須包含消息。 -d [u][p]:xx:yy 列出系統關閉的原因代碼。下表將列出不同的值。 值 說明 u 指定用戶代碼。 p 指定已計劃的關閉代碼。 xx 指定主要原因代碼 (0-255)。 yy 指定次要原因代碼 (0-65536)。
 ?/? 在命令提示符顯示幫助。
 ?2.at 命令的參數:At計劃在指定時間和日期在計算機上運行命令和程序。at 命令只能在“計劃”服務運行時使用。如果在沒有參數的情況下使用,則 at 列出已計劃的命令。at [[\\ComputerName] hours:minutes [/interactive] [{/every:date[,...]|/next:date[,...]}] command]參數\\computername 指定遠程計算機。如果省略該參數,則 at 計劃本地計算機上的命令和程序。 ID 指定指派給已計劃命令的識別碼。 /delete 取消已計劃的命令。如果省略了 ID,則計算機中所有已計劃的命令將被取消。 /yes 刪除已計劃的事件時,對來自系統的所有詢問都回答“是”。 hours:minutes 指定命令運行的時間。該時間用 24 小時制(即從 00:00 [午夜] 到 23:59)的 小時: 分鐘格式表示。 terative 對于在運行 command 時登錄的用戶,允許 command 與該用戶的桌面進行交互。 /every: 在每個星期或月的指定日期(例如,每個星期四,或每月的第三天)運行 command 命令。 date 指定運行命令的日期。可以指定一周的某日或多日(即,鍵入 M、T、W、Th、F、S、Su)或一個月中的某日或多日(即,鍵入從 1 到31 之間的數字)。用逗號分隔多個日期項。如果省略了 date,則 at 使用該月的當前日。 /next: 在下一個指定日期(比如,下一個星期四)到來時運行 command。 command 指定要運行的 Windows 命令、程序(.exe 或 .com 文件)或批處理程序(.bat 或 .cmd 文件)。當命令需要路徑作為參數時,請使用絕對路徑,也就是從驅動器號開始的整個路徑。如果命令在遠程計算機上,請指定服務器和共享名的通用命名協定 (UNC) 符號,而不是遠程驅動器號。
?
?
補充:對于自動關機沒有反應的情況,在cmd 下輸入 關機命令 說:服務沒有啟動 你應該是沒有啟動對應服務吧?
 
 在開始——運行——services.msc
 
 找到Task Scheduler,把啟動類型改為"自動",應用后啟動。
 ?
總結
以上是生活随笔為你收集整理的Windowsnbsp;XP自动开关机的实现的全部內容,希望文章能夠幫你解決所遇到的問題。
 
                            
                        - 上一篇: 关于国内Android游戏的真相
- 下一篇: 牛客网比赛-Wannafly挑战赛27
